    David-
    The fact that Kodo can integrate into an application server as a
    Resource Adaptor, and section 3.2.2 of the specification that says that
    the PersistentManagerFactory should be able to utilize a Resource
    Adaptor to obtain connections to the data store are two separate issues.
    We implement Kodo itself as a Resource Adaptor in order to provide ease
    of integration into recent application servers. Your confusion is
    understandable, since we do not actually yet support the use of Resource
    Adaptors as the Connection Factories as per section 3.2.2.
    Does that make sense?

    siriusb wrote:
    The configuration files in /etc are for system-wide settings. These are the default settings if not overridden by a user's own settings in their home directory.
    So running vim as your regular user will use the settings from your home directory.
    What does sudo? From man sudo
    sudo allows a permitted user to execute a command as the superuser or another user, as specified by the security policy.
    So if you didn't specify any setting in the home folder of the user you want to run vim as, and you don't have anything in /etc/vimrc, vim won't apply any custom settings.

    Stuart8, good find, that article.
    I found the main disincentive to using the built-in S/MIME capability is that it's not immediately obvious where to get your certificate and keys. Most providers want $$$ for them, which is natural enough if they are actually going to validate you in some way. I did at one time have a Thawte certificate and even enough WOT vouches to be a low-grade WOT Attorney.
    Once you have your key, it's a bit of a pfaff to install it into Thunderbird. You'll probably find that S/MIME is the default in business correspondence, since many businesses operate their own mail servers, ftp servers and so on and probably have an arrangement to generate self-issued certificates or to buy them on a commercial basis from a CA.
    Enigmail/OpenPGP doesn't require any financial outlay on your part, but is harder to get your keys properly validated since there's not much of a formal WOT nor a reliable central registry. You generate your own keys and it's pretty much all based on mutual trust.
    Since the two systems are incompatible, you need to have set up the same as whatever your correspondent is using.
    I suspect that you have discovered that it's a two-way process. In order for a correspondent to send you an encrypted message, you must both be using the same system, and he must have your public key to encrypt his message, and you'll need his in order to reply with encryption. So yes, he needs to send you his public key for you to send to him, but what he sends to you needs YOUR public key.
    Obviously, signing messages is a useful halfway house. I believe that you sign with your private key, and the recipient will have to download your public key to validate your signature. Whilst a signature doesn't safeguard your privacy, it goes some way to proving that the message came from who it says it came from and that it hasn't been altered in transit.   • Validating CSV File BEFORE importing and moving using an SSIS package

    I'm trying to come up with a process (I'm used to doing this kind of stuff in T-SQL) in SSIS to grab a collection of .csv files from a folder, validate them, then depending on if they pass validation, import them into my database and move them into an archive
    folder. If the .csv does not pass validation, then it does not get imported, and instead gets placed into an error folder. The validation requirements is that the Column2 of my .csv contains a WKT text field and the file is considered valid if every record
    can be successfully converted into a Geometry/Geography type field. 
    Column0 Column1 Column2
    abcd efgh LINESTRING (-71.4555487 41.6079686, -71.4550113 41.6088851)
    ijkl mnop LINESTRING (-70.0748669 48.6634506, -70.0499 48.6548479)
    qrst uvwx LINESTRING (-70.3159285 48.4199802, -70.3168512 48.4187551)

    FOr that what you can do is dump the records to staging table and use STisValid function
    see
    http://technet.microsoft.com/en-us/library/bb933890.aspx
    finally take the count of failed ones and if cnt > 0 set boolean value as true/false. Then for true cases move data to final table and for false cases (invalid values), move it to error folder
    So package will look like below
    1. Data flow task to transfer data to staging
    2. execute sql task to call a procedure which does validation on staging data and returns a bit result. Set it to SSIS variable using output variable from procedure
    3. Connect to data flow task to do transfer from staging to destination. the precedence constraint option would be Expression And Constraint with expression as 
    @BooleanVariable == True
    and constraint as OnSuccess
    4. Connect to file system task to archive the file. the precedence constraint option would be Expression And Constraint with expression as 
    @BooleanVariable == False
    and constraint as OnSuccess
